Particle pollution in the Balkans is the highest in Europe, research finds

Friday 23rd January 2026, 6:00AM

Study also says Balkan levels are often higher than in Beijing – and sometimes among the highest in the worldWhen we think of the world’s most polluted cities, images of Delhi or Beijing come to mind, but new data has revealed acute pollution problems close to the heart of Europe.Prof Andre Prevot, of the Paul Scherrer Institute (PSI) in Switzerland, explained: “In winter, the particle pollution in the Balkans is the highest in Europe. Particle pollution levels are often higher than in Beijing and on some days they are among the highest in the world. Sulphur dioxide in winter can be over 30 times greater than what we normally see in western Europe.” Continue reading...
